2.2.5

-------------------
* conda build: move broken packages to conda-bld/broken
* conda config: automatically add the 'defaults' channel
* conda build: improve error handling for invalid recipe directory
* add ability to set build string, issue 425
* fix LD_RUN_PATH not being set on Linux under Python 3,
see issue 427, thanks peter1000

2.2.4

-------------------
* add support for execution with the -m switch (issue 398), i.e. you
can execute conda also as: python -m conda
* add a deactivate script for windows
* conda build adds .pth-file when it encounters an egg (TODO)
* add ability to preserve egg directory when building using
build/preserve_egg_dir: True
* allow track_features in ~/.condarc
* Allow arbitrary source, issue 405
* fixed minor issues: 393, 402, 409, 413

2.2.3

-------------------
* add "foreign mode", i.e. disallow install of certain packages when
using a "foreign" Python, such as the system Python
* remove activate/deactivate from source tarball created by sdist.sh,
in order to not overwrite activate script from virtualenvwrapper

2.2.2

-------------------
* remove ARCH environment variable for being able to change architecture
* add PKG_NAME, PKG_VERSION to environment when running build.sh,
.<name>-post-link.sh and .<name>-pre-unlink.sh

2.2.1

-------------------
* minor fixes related to make conda pip installable
* generated conda meta-data missing 'files' key, fixed issue 357

2.2.0

-------------------
* add conda init command, to allow installing conda via pip
* fix prefix being replaced by placeholder after conda build on Unix
* add 'use_pip' to condarc configuration file
* fixed activate on Windows to set CONDA_DEFAULT_ENV
* allow setting "always_yes: True" in condarc file, which implies always
using the --yes option whenever asked to proceed
